Scope of Work
1. Exterior Brick Wall Repair
The team began by reinforcing the affected structure and carefully removing all deteriorated bricks.
- Damaged bricks were replaced with new ones closely matching the originals.
- The wall was then repointed using mortar selected to visually and functionally align with the existing structure.
Note: While an exact brick/mortar match could not be guaranteed due to material availability, the end result was aesthetically cohesive and structurally sound.
2. Interior Cinder Block Wall – Crack Reinforcement
This wall had multiple structural cracks needing specialized repair. Zavza Seal’s process included:
- Removing and replacing weakened sections with new cinder blocks or high-strength mortar.
- Cutting perpendicular slots along cracks every 6 inches to allow for reinforcement.
- Injecting structural epoxy into the slots.
- Installing carbon fiber stitches into the epoxy. Each stitch holds up to 6,500 lbs of tensile force, which helps:
- Prevent future crack widening
- Restore tensile strength
- Re-establish wall compression
To finish, Zavza Seal applied two layers of Sika 107 waterproofing cement with 4.5 oz reinforced fibermesh sandwiched in between, sealing the repairs against moisture infiltration.
3. Garage Door Framing Replacement
The garage door support structure had begun to fail, posing both safety and functional concerns.
- The team removed and set aside the existing garage door assembly.
- Installed new pressure-treated wood frames (2″x6″x12′), securely anchored to the cinder block wall.
- Reinstalled the garage door assembly into its original location, ensuring full operability and structural reliability.
